Amritsar: On February 17, before the Punjab Assembly elections, a letter in the name of the banned Khalistani organization Sikh for Justice (SFJ) is going viral on social media. In this, it was said that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) will support CM face Bhagwant Mann in Punjab. In this letter issued in the Punjabi language in the name of Gurpatwant Singh Pannu, it is written that, 'We all members of Sikh for Justice declare our support to Bhagwant Mann of Aam Aadmi Party in the Punjab Assembly Elections. These elections are very important. If the AAP government is formed in Punjab, then it will be easy for us to achieve our goal of Khalistan.'

The letter further read that 'we had supported AAP in the 2017 elections also. It is only AAP, which can get our target fulfilled. Strengthen us by voting for them.' However, after the letter went viral, Pannu immediately released the video calling it fake. Pannu said in his video, 'This letter is fake and SFJ has not extended its support to any political party. It has been made viral by AAP and Bhagwant Mann. SFJ does not believe in the Constitution of India and political parties.'

 

Pannu also said 'Our target is to separate Punjab from India. Referendum and voting will also be conducted soon for this. Stay away from the lies of the AAP party. I warn Bhagwant Mann and Kejriwal. Be it Indira, Modi or Kejriwal, whoever comes from Delhi will be opposed. I urge everyone to hoist the Khalistani flag at the polling booths.'
